>>42104295>I originally thought this was about making AI become self-aware and conscious, but turns out something else is using the AI and talking through it.You were naive then and you're naive now.Learn how LLMs are built.>But if you treat it like a person, things change.The AI is set to adjust interactions depending on user and how said user approached AI. It's part of the programming.>It's the same result every time, proving that these symbols are archetypal somehow.No, it simply means that toward your particular bullshit, there's limited choice of learning data on which AI could build varied responses.>Anyway, watch Gemini's whole personality change, and become way more coherent than normal.Again, it's not getting more coherent, it's just getting more adjusted to the format of reply it assumes, based on recognized pattern, is the closest to the user's preference. Start suddenly talking to it in painfully stereotypical ebonics in the middle of your bullshit and watch it adjust to that as well after a while.You're a painfully gullible person dumb like a bag of hammers. Instead of getting hyped up by "babby's first fucking around with AI", ask it questions about what makes it decide on that particular answer, point out it changes style of response and ask why etc etc - you will learn that it's all a part of the basic feature set. >>42125881>I've been thinking about how they wanted it unregulated, because they desire a Skynet type AI that will kill without question.Sorry anon, but it's bullshit only someone who doesn't know how AI works would write, mostly because "AI that will kill without question" is _default_. The most basic, simple AI is exactly that. It's making one that is effective while moral, flexible in behavior and able to test boundaries of its guardrails for good enough reason without breaking them - THAT is hard to make.
